The Slip by Lucas Schaefer. It’s a litfic book about a lot of things, including boxing and a missing teenager. There are many characters and many points of view. One focal character is trans, but they don’t show up until about halfway through the book. It’s a long book (about 500 pages), but really interesting. Lots to discuss.
